An Electronic Parts Catalog (EPC) serves as an interactive blueprint of a vehicle. The digitizes thousands of mechanical components, electrical schematics, and body parts for every model manufactured under Great Wall Motors.
stands for Great Wall Motor Electronic Parts Catalog . It is a specialized software database used by dealerships, authorized repair shops, and parts distributors to locate the exact technical drawings, part numbers, and descriptions for every component built into a GWM vehicle. gwm epc
